Three layers, one system

The three-layer structure

Layer 1 — Emerging Leaders National Network

The umbrella entity. Qualifies chapter applicants, holds standards, coordinates across regions, connects funders to the field, and manages the platform and toolkit. The network is incubated with Cities United as fiduciary.

Layer 2 — Emerging Leaders Chapters

City-level entities with their own identity and leadership. Detroit is the first chapter and the proof of concept. Each chapter is earned — not granted — through the qualification pipeline. More chapters are emerging across the East Coast, the South, the West Coast, and the Midwest.

Layer 3 — The Build Peace Framework

The branded service strategy delivered inside every chapter. A common language that makes the network legible to funders, practitioners, and policymakers across cities.

Why This Structure

The network stays behind the chapter

A national brand doesn't survive in community violence intervention. Trust is local. Relationships are local. The chapter holds the local identity while the network holds the standards and the infrastructure.

This is how you scale CVI without losing what makes it work. Detroit doesn't become "the ELNN chapter in Detroit." Detroit stays Detroit — and the network makes Detroit replicable.
